Loading

上一页 1 ··· 13 14 15 16 17 18 19 20 21 ··· 85 下一页
摘要: 最小生成树是指在一个图中,由连接所有顶点的边构成的权值之和最小的树,求最小生成树的算法主要有Prim算法及Kruskal算法,此处介绍Prim算法的基本原理。 Prim算法是一种贪心算法,不过可以证明,此算法得到的必定是全局最优解。Prim算法的基本思路如下: 将图中的所有顶点分为两个集合,Know 阅读全文
posted @ 2022-10-02 21:03 RioTian 阅读(228) 评论(0) 推荐(0)
摘要: 研究生考试中图论中求解最短路径的算法主要有两种,Dijkstra算法及Floyd算法,其中Dijkstra算法用于求解单源最短路径问题,而Floyd算法则用于解决多源最短路径问题。本文对这两种算法做一总结。 Dijkstra算法 Dijkstra算法是最经典的最短路径算法,这是一种典型的贪心算法,不 阅读全文
posted @ 2022-10-02 21:01 RioTian 阅读(260) 评论(0) 推荐(0)
摘要: AVL树是一种特殊的二叉查找树,其特征在于:对所有节点来说,其左子树和右子树间的高度差小于等于1。本文简要总结下AVL树的几种基本操作。 节点结构体定义 typedef struct Node_s { int element; struct Node_s * left, * right; int h 阅读全文
posted @ 2022-10-02 20:55 RioTian 阅读(146) 评论(0) 推荐(0)
该文被密码保护。 阅读全文
posted @ 2022-09-19 17:12 RioTian 阅读(0) 评论(0) 推荐(0)
摘要: 该文被密码保护。阅读全文 阅读全文
posted @ 2022-09-14 16:25 RioTian 阅读(3855) 评论(1) 推荐(2)
摘要: OS | 进程和线程基础知识全家桶图文详解✨ 前言 先来看看一则小故事 我们写好的一行行代码,为了让其工作起来,我们还得把它送进城(进程)里,那既然进了城里,那肯定不能胡作非为了。 城里人有城里人的规矩,城中有个专门管辖你们的城管(操作系统),人家让你休息就休息,让你工作就工作,毕竟摊位(CPU)就一个,每个人都要占这个摊位来工作,城里要工作的 阅读全文
posted @ 2022-08-20 17:40 RioTian 阅读(170) 评论(0) 推荐(0)
摘要: 什么是inode? 每个文件都对应一个唯一的inode,inode用来存储文件的元信息,包括: 对应的文件 文件字节数 文件数据块的位置 文件的inode号码 文件的硬链接数 文件的读写权限 文件的时间戳 在Linux系统下,创建一个文件hello.txt echo 'hello world' -> 阅读全文
posted @ 2022-08-19 09:29 RioTian 阅读(112) 评论(0) 推荐(0)
摘要: 今天一位朋友去一个不错的外企面试 Linux 开发职位,面试官出了一个如下的题目: 给出如下C程序,在 Linux 下使用 gcc 编译: #include "stdio.h" #include "sys/types.h" #include "unistd.h" int main() { pid_t 阅读全文
posted @ 2022-08-19 08:57 RioTian 阅读(89) 评论(0) 推荐(0)
该文被密码保护。 阅读全文
posted @ 2022-08-11 16:45 RioTian 阅读(0) 评论(0) 推荐(0)
该文被密码保护。 阅读全文
posted @ 2022-08-11 16:41 RioTian 阅读(0) 评论(0) 推荐(0)
该文被密码保护。 阅读全文
posted @ 2022-08-11 16:38 RioTian 阅读(0) 评论(0) 推荐(0)
摘要: 知识框架 对称矩阵 三角矩阵 三对角矩阵 稀疏矩阵 阅读全文
posted @ 2022-08-10 16:47 RioTian 阅读(54) 评论(0) 推荐(1)
摘要: From 知乎up 是木野真呀 我大学时认识一个通讯社的学姐。 她是我见过考研最疯狂的人,她的目标是北师大! 目标不低,但是考研没有跨专业,所以也还算稳妥。 大三那年秋天,我们一起出去吃了一顿饭,回来的时候,她跟我说: 我准备明年考研,从今年开始复习,你要是有什么事着急找我,就打电话,如果不是很急, 阅读全文
posted @ 2022-08-08 21:28 RioTian 阅读(261) 评论(0) 推荐(1)
摘要: 文件系统总结 逻辑文件面向用户,学习时应该掌握不同的逻辑文件之间的特点 目录文件时链接逻辑文件和物理文件的桥梁,学习时应该体会到目录文件时如何优化访问时间 物理文件是指文件的数据如何存储在磁盘等存储设备上,主要内容就是分配方式,掌握不同的分配方式特点 逻辑文件 逻辑文件是对用户而言,包括顺序文件,直 阅读全文
posted @ 2022-08-08 16:52 RioTian 阅读(359) 评论(0) 推荐(1)
摘要: 算法简介 银行家算法(Banker’s Algorithm)是一个避免死锁( Deadlock)的著名算法,是由艾兹格·迪杰斯特拉在1965年为T.H.E系统设计的一种避免死锁产生的算法。它以银行借贷系统的分配策略为基础,判断并保证系统的安全运行。 算法目的 为了了解系统的资源分配情况,假定系统的任 阅读全文
posted @ 2022-08-04 16:41 RioTian 阅读(842) 评论(0) 推荐(0)
上一页 1 ··· 13 14 15 16 17 18 19 20 21 ··· 85 下一页